Do you remember the last time you laughed so hard you leaned back afterwards, sighed and said, “Oh, I needed that!”?
Therapeutic humour promotes health and wellness and can be used to facilitate healing or coping whether physical, emotional, social or spiritual. In a moment of laughter or humour, we are drained of our fears and worries, and we are refilled with joy and delight!
These joyful, positive emotions stimulate our bodies natural healing ability.
